Originally Posted by techno_violet
Is the Akrapovic exhaust no longer an option from the factory? I'm not seeing it on the configurator anymore. (I'm located in the US).

I had a build saved in the '19 configurator which was no longer compatible, so I spec'd a '20 and didn't see many of the accessories that were previously offered. I'm planning on putting in an order in the next month or so.
So I don’t think Akrapovic exhaust was the performance exhaust offered from AMG. It was simply an “AMG performance exhaust” which I believe is now standard equipment in the US.

Akrapovic makes amazing titanium aftermarket exhausts. They cost $10k+, and you can buy one for your E63s. Interesting this is, a couple of years ago, you could option an Audi S7/RS7 with a factory-installed Akrapovic exhaust for $9,900, which is hilarious if you’re leasing tbh.
